This issue focuses on the promised Apple Intelligence features in macOS 15.2 Sequoia, iOS 18.2, and iPadOS 18.2, plus the solid list of other enhancements in those operating systems and watchOS 11.2, visionOS 2.2, tvOS 18.2, and HomePod Software 18.2. Adam Engst then dives into how Apple has integrated ChatGPT into Siri and comes up disappointed. In late-breaking news, Shirt Pocket Software says macOS 15.2 prevents SuperDuper from making bootable backups—hold off on updating or upgrading if you rely on such backups. Notable Mac app releases this week include Airfoil 5.12.4 and Audio Hijack 4.4.5, BBEdit 15.1.3, Default Folder X 6.1.3, Keynote 14.3, Numbers 14.3, and Pages 14.3, Lightroom Classic 14.1, Mellel 6.2, Merlin Project 9.0, Microsoft Office for Mac 16.92, OmniFocus 4.5, Safari 18.2, Scrivener 3.4, and Web Confidential 5.5.
